Global Welding Equipment Market Is Estimated To Witness High Growth Owing to Growing Adoption of Automation in Manufacturing Processes
The global Welding Equipment Market is estimated to be valued at US$ 16.82 billion in 2022 and is expected to exhibit a CAGR of 10.54% over the forecast period 2023-2030, as highlighted in a new report published by Coherent Market Insights.
A) Market Overview:
Welding equipment refers to the tools and machines used in the process of joining two or more metal parts together by applying heat or pressure. These equipment offer several advantages such as increased efficiency, improved productivity, and enhanced quality of welds. The need for welding equipment arises in various industries including automotive, construction, manufacturing, and energy, among others. With the growing demand for automation in manufacturing processes and the need for precise and efficient welding, there is a significant market opportunity for welding equipment.
B) Market Key Trends:
One key trend driving the growth of the welding equipment market is the growing adoption of automation in manufacturing processes. Automated welding systems offer several benefits such as increased precision, faster production times, reduced labor costs, and improved safety. For instance, robotic welding systems are being increasingly utilized in automotive manufacturing for high-volume production. These systems provide consistent and high-quality welds, resulting in improved product quality.

2: In terms of regional analysis, Asia Pacific is expected to be the fastest-growing and dominating region in the global welding equipment market. This can be attributed to rapid industrialization, infrastructure development, and the presence of key market players in countries like China and India.
3: Key players operating in the global welding equipment market include Amada Miyachi, Inc., Arcon Welding Equipment, Colfax Corporation, DAIHEN Corporation, ESAB Welding & Cutting Products, Fronius International GmbH, Illinois Tool Works, Inc., Nelson Stud Welding (Doncasters Group, Ltd.), Obara Corporation, Panasonic Corporation, Rofin-Sinar Technologies, Sonics & Materials, Inc., The Lincoln Electric Company, and Voestalpine AG.
